Prioritizing Mental Wellness
Taking care of your behavioral health is just as important as maintaining physical wellness. Your emotional and mental well-being influence your daily life, relationships and overall health. Prioritizing mental wellness is a journey, not a destination. By building health habits, seeking support when needed and making self-care a priority, you can cultivate a balanced, resilient mind.
